Relief kits provide valuable supplies to families whose lives have been disrupted by war or disaster. Practical gifts of soap, towels and other useful items help people know they are not alone; someone cares about them.

Families receive hand-made comforters made by our volunteers. Donated fabric is cut into squares and sewn into tops for comforters that are knotted and bound.

Donations of cardboard, clothing, bric-a-brac, and medical equipment and books are sorted and baled in the warehouse before being sold to brokers and shipped to other countries.

Volunteers cut donated 100% cotton t-shirts into rag sized pieces. These rags are sold to local business people such as plumbers and mechanics.

The Mennonite Central Committee ships material goods that we produce and package all throughout the world to meet the needs of people living in poverty.

Mennonite Central Committee (MCC) is a global, nonprofit organization that strives to share God’s love and compassion for all through relief, development and peacebuilding. MCC has been empowering communities to meet local needs and build peace for over 100 years.
